“Be able to fight the Mercs,” Esteban Ocon aspires to fight Mercedes after a sequence of upgrades planned for Alpine

Esteban Ocon
Esteban Ocon is optimistic about the upcoming Alpine upgrades and hopes for a fight with the “big boys” on the top. Currently the best Alpine could do is to beat McLaren for the fourth spot in the championship and can considerably do it as both the teams are level on points in the championship, 81 each. This is an appreciable achievement for the French team, after a fascinating jump they have managed since the 2021 season, Alpine managed to score 155 points and was fifth on the table with a gap of 120 points to the fourth finisher McLaren.
This time around Alpine has built hopes to fight the likes of Mercedes, currently, the Silver Arrows are 156 ahead of the French team, but Esteban Ocon still hopes for a tough fight to touch the top. Alpine are dependent on the upgrades and is willing to put all their money on it until the budget stops them to. Mercedes seems way ahead currently for their reach but it’s a win if they manage to get a fight with the 2021 winners on regular basis. Ocon managed a P5 finish in Austria that is bossing his confidence currently.
“Yeah. At the moment, that’s where we are of course. As much as we have improved the car, we haven’t improved it enough yet to be able to fight the Mercs. But it is the aim to fight higher, for sure, and it’s still early days and I have hopes we can at some point fight with them, ” Esteban Ocon enlightens his and the team’s aim for the upcoming months.
“There are plans to bring more things to the car and we’ve seen since Silverstone the team brought an upgrade and made a massive step up. So that’s still on the way and we will keep going, “ reviews Ocon on the upcoming upgrades for Alpine.

Esteban Ocon also opens up on the fight with his teammate Fernando Alonso

The two-time world champion joined the grid again in 2021 with Alpine. He was able to beat his teammate but things weren’t much worse for Ocon, he was only 7 points behind his teammate. Currently, he is 23 ahead of his teammate, but things aren’t going easy for the world champion ha has already lost points over his bad luck keeping him behind his teammate.
“Well, I’m in front of him in the championship at the moment and we are still pushing each other in the team. It’s going well for me at the moment, I’m pretty pleased. It’s very close, he’s mega at every race, he’s consistently pushing and that’s what brings the team performance up as well, and we are happy with the collaboration since last year, ” said Esteban Ocon.
Ocon managed a P5 in Austria marking his highest finish this season equalling his teammate’s finish in Silverstone. With France GP up next, the home teams will be looking for a better position to finish and a podium might just be a cherry on the cake.
